There exists a wide array of data annotation techniques, each tailored to meet specific challenges and maximize AI performance. Some common methods include:
* **Image Annotation:** Labeling objects within images, such as pedestrians, to develop computer vision models.
* **Text Annotation:** Classifying text data based on topic to improve natural language processing capabilities.
* **Audio Annotation:** Transcribing speech patterns and sounds in audio recordings to develop speech recognition systems.

The Backbone of ML
Data annotation is often overlooked, but it's the crucial foundation upon which successful machine learning models are built. Without accurately labeled data, algorithms struggle to understand patterns and make accurate predictions. It's like teaching a child missing clear examples; they simply cannot grasp the concepts.
Think of data annotation as the link between raw data and valuable knowledge. Annotators carefully tag information, providing machines with the context they need to perform effectively.
- Consider, in image recognition, data annotators draw rectangles around objects within images, teaching the algorithm to detect them.
- Also, in natural language processing, text is labeled with parts of speech or sentiment.
The here accuracy of data annotation directly impacts the effectiveness of any machine learning model. It's a essential investment that lays the path for truly intelligent systems.

The Evolving Landscape of Data Annotation: Trends and Future Directions
Data annotation has evolved significantly in recent years, driven by the unprecedented growth of data and the increasing demand for high-quality training datasets.
One notable trend is the implementation of artificial intelligence (AI) to automate annotation tasks. This methodology aims to boost efficiency and reduce costs while maintaining data accuracy.
Another key trend is the growth of crowdsourcing platforms that connect businesses with a worldwide pool of annotators. This system provides access to a extensive workforce and allows for the annotation of large-scale datasets in a efficient manner.
